> Not to mention the idea of a session "timeout" being the last time > you accessed a server is a dangerous concept. If using something > like dynamic IMP, your session will NEVER time out. So your proposal > actually opens up additional security holes. > > The only way to correctly "timeout" a session is to implement a time > limit AT THE TIME OF THE INITIAL AUTHENTICATION. This is what we > provide via the max_time configuration option. Anything else might > help in certain situations (e.g. a single user system) but will hurt > in other situations (a single user system where the user never closes > their browser).
